HUGHES v. STATE

No. 3295.

302 S.W.2d 747 (1957)

Jack HUGHES, Appellant, v. STATE of Texas, Appellee.

Court of Civil Appeals of Texas, Eastland.

Rehearing Denied June 7, 1957.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

McMahon, Smart, Walter, Sprain & Wilson, Abilene, for appellant.

Theo Ash, Lee Sutton, County Atty., Abilene, for appellee.


LONG, Justice.

This is a condemnation proceeding brought by the State of Texas to acquire for road purposes approximately 20 acres of land adjacent to U. S. Highway 80 belonging to Jack Hughes. Commissioners were appointed, a hearing was had and an award of $81,766 was duly made and filed.
